    The insulation of a composite door is measured by its U-value, which measures how well it stifles heat out and in. The lower the U value, the more energy-efficient the product. Many composite doors have a low U-value, which allows them to comply with ENERGY STAR requirements and save money on your energy bills.

    Moreover, uPVC frames are usually reinforced so that intruders find it difficult to force doors open from the outside. The glazed parts of the door are made of toughened or laminated glass which makes it virtually impossible to break. This type of glass is five times stronger than normal glass that is annealed and can break into small pieces if it is broken, making it incredibly difficult to gain entry into your home through the door.
